thanks for sharing. i’m in charge of the blennys.Hi Everybody & welcome to my journey back into saltwater!
In July 2020, after about 15 years out of the hobby, I jumped back in!
I know many others have found their way back, especially with little or nothing to do during the beginning of the pandemic.
As a nurse, working 2 jobs, even during the pandemic, I was not one of those with little or nothing to do.
I was overworked, underpaid, and overwhelmed with anxiety and depression.
SO! I found this on FB Marketplace for $200 and said, let's go!
I started doing all kinds of reading again, joined FB groups and starting asking tons of questions and couldn't believe how much equipment had changed since getting out of the hobby. So I went ahead and "splurged" on the Tunze 9012 skimmer, a couple powerheads, a heater, and Fluval Marine 3.0 lights.
Ladies & Gentleman, I have since learned the importance of patience and saving up for proper equipment.
But! This is a learning journey for me and it took my mind off the dark cloud that had been hovering over my head.
This was July 12, 2020!
And seeing me come so alive with my new project, my then boyfriend who was supporting me mentally, emotionally, decided to propose as I dried my hands after adjusting my rockscape!
